Get startedKellwell House is a detached house in Hellifield, Skipton, Skipton (BD23 4HE). It has a recorded floor area of 247 m² (around 2659 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1983-1990 and council tax band F. The latest certificate (September 2018) shows a D (score 66),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. The rating has held steady at D across 2 certificates since November 2010. Between certificates, lighting went from Average to Very Good; while hot-water efficiency dropped from Very Good to Average and main heating dropped from Very Good to Good.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 84), a 2-band jump.
At 247 m² the property is well over the postcode median (92 m² across 14 EPCs), placing it in the larger end of the local stock. Last sold in August 2011, so it's been off the market for around 15 years. Today's modelled estimate of £585,000 is 48.1% above the 2011 sale price. One historical planning record sits against the property in 2006.
Kellwell House's carbon output runs well above what efficient homes in the postcode produce.
